What Makes a No KYC Casino Different?
Standard online casinos demand identity proof before you can spin a reel. A no KYC casino flips that. You register with minimal info-often just an email or a crypto wallet link-and you’re gambling immediately. Many never ask for documents unless you hit a withdrawal threshold or trigger an anti-money laundering check. For routine play, you stay anonymous.
This isn’t about dodging rules. It’s about speed and privacy. Crypto payments (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in, USDT) move on blockchain networks, not slow banking rails. Withdrawals that take days at a UKGC-licensed site often clear in minutes here. Transaction fees? Lower. Privacy? Better.

The Trade-Offs You Need to Know
No KYC doesn’t mean no checks. Behind the scenes, casinos still run automated security: IP monitoring, device fingerprinting, transaction analysis. If you request a large withdrawal or trigger a fraud alert, they may ask for documents. That’s rare for normal play, but it happens.
The bigger catch is licensing. Most no KYC casinos operate under offshore licences (Curaçao, Malta, Anjouan), not the UK Gambling Commission. That means less regulatory oversight. Consumer protections and responsible gambling tools vary. A reputable operator still offers SSL encryption, two-factor authentication, deposit limits, and self-exclusion. But not all do. You have to pick carefully.
How to Choose a Trusted No KYC Casino
Don’t just grab the first flashy site. Look for:
- A visible licence and clear ownership
- Positive player reviews on payout reliability
- SSL encryption and 2FA
- Transparent withdrawal limits and processing times
- Responsive customer support (24/7 live chat is a green flag)
Red flags include no licence, hidden fees, vague terms, or repeated complaints about unpaid withdrawals. If it feels off, walk.
